Ilkley engineering company Ideal Extraction has announced an office move to the International Development Centre on Valley Road as a result of business expansion.
Ideal Extraction, owned by directors Steve and Helen Rhodes, design, install and maintain dust and fume extraction systems for many sectors across the UK.
The company had been trading from premises at the Lencia Industrial Estates since 2020, but the addition of new employees due to the increase in business necessitated a larger office facility.
They have retained their warehouse operations at the industrial estate, but all office staff now work at the Grade II listed Development Centre.
The company will be celebrating its fifth birthday this year, although Steve and Helen have many years of experience in the industry after previously owning a successful company, Cades Ltd, which operated in the same field from 1996 until 2015.
The expansion and office move mark a significant milestone for the business which has established a reputation for delivering exceptional service with an impeccable attention to detail, as well as building long lasting relationships with their clients.
They are also the proud sole UK supplier for Denmark-based Moldow A/S, a leading international supplier of industrial dust and fume extraction machinery.
Speaking about the move, Helen said:
“We’re delighted to be working at the International Development Centre. It’s such a beautiful building, both inside and out, which successfully combines a wealth of heritage and historical significance with 21st century state-of-the-art facilities.
“We’re also very happy that we’ll be able to celebrate our fifth trading anniversary in our new offices. A fifth anniversary is traditionally marked by the gift of wood, which does seem very apt given our line of work and the fact that we work with some very well-known high street furniture manufacturers.
“The move reflects our commitment to continue providing well designed and top-class dust extraction solutions to our clients and we’re very much looking forward to continued growth and success.”
Ideal Extraction work with companies of all sizes and offer servicing, maintenance and Local Exhaust Ventilation testing of existing extraction equipment as well as new installations.
